#a41239 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a41239 is composed of 64.3% red, 7.1%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89% magenta, 65.2%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 344 degrees, a saturation of 80.2% and a lightness of 35.7%. #a41239 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2472 with #490000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#a41239 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a41239 has RGB values of R:164, G:18,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.65,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10752569.

Shades and Tints of #a41239
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050102 is the darkest color, while #fef2f5 is the lightest one.
